Pacific Coast species are not a good group to start with in Zone 5 Indiana, though. Other non-bulb, non-water irises that will flower in shade include cristata and foetidissima. In Zone 5 both would probably appreciate several hours of morning sun.

Pacific Coast iris flower fine for me in shade. Siberians occasionally flower. Bearded flower for a year or two whenever a few trees blow down.
